R.E.M. were an American rock band from Athens, Georgia, formed in 1980 who became one of the first alternative rock bands to achieve mainstream success. Michael Stipe's enigmatic vocals, Peter Buck's jangly guitar, Mike Mills' melodic bass, and Bill Berry's steady drumming created a distinctive sound. Early albums like 'Murmur' and 'Reckoning' defined college rock, while 'Document,' 'Green,' and 'Out of Time' brought them to massive audiences. Hits including 'Losing My Religion,' 'Man on the Moon,' and 'Everybody Hurts' became defining songs of their era. R.E.M.'s influence on alternative rock was foundational, proving that independent-minded rock could achieve commercial success without compromise.
